Road cycling in Landes De Gascogne offers an extensive network of routes through diverse landscapes. The region is characterized by vast pine forests, known as the "pignada," which provide shaded paths and fresh air. Cyclists can also find routes along the Leyre River, through wetlands, and around various lakes. The terrain ranges from flat forest roads to gentle rolling hills, making it suitable for different cycling pre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of landscapes will I encounter on road cycling routes in Landes De Gascogne?

Landes De Gascogne offers a diverse cycling environment. You'll primarily ride through vast pine forests, known as the "pignada," which provide shaded paths and fresh air. Routes also follow the Leyre River, often called the "Little Amazon," and wind through wetlands and around various lakes. The terrain generally ranges from flat forest roads to gentle rolling hills, catering to different preferences.

Are there road cycling routes su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Landes De Gascogne has numerous easy routes perfect for beginners and families. For instance, the Small loop around Labouheyre is an easy 25-mile (40.2 km) path that winds through characteristic pine forests, offering a serene experience. Overall, 66 of the available routes are classified as easy.

What are some interesting places to see along the road cycling routes?

Landes De Gascogne offers several attractions along its routes. You can explore the Teich Ornithological Reserve, a haven for birdwatchers, or visit the Port of Biganos. The region also features beautiful lakes, such as those near the Hostens lake beach, providing scenic stops and opportunities for relaxation.

What is the best season for road biking in Landes De Gascogne?

The region is generally pleasant for cycling from spring through autumn. The vast pine forests offer welcome shade during warmer months, and the mild climate makes it enjoyable for most of the year. For birdwatching enthusiasts, visiting between mid-October and mid-March allows you to see thousands of common cranes at the Arjuzanx Nature Reserve.

Are there routes that connect to major European cycle networks?

Yes, Landes De Gascogne is traversed by major European routes like EuroVélo 1 (Vélodyssée) and EuroVélo 3 (Scandibérique). These routes offer long-distance cycling opportunities, showcasing diverse landscapes from coastal areas to the Armagnac wine region. The Loop between the pins on the Euro bike 3 is an example of a route that connects to this network.

Are there any cultural or historical sites accessible by bike?

Yes, the Ecomuseum of Marquèze is accessible via a dedicated cycle path. This museum offers a unique journey back to 19th-century rural Gascony, allowing visitors to explore traditional houses and learn about the region's agro-pastoral heritage, making for an enriching cultural stop during your ride.

Are there routes that offer views of the coast or lakes?

Absolutely. While known for its forests, the region also features routes around lakes and connections to the nearby Arcachon Basin. The Lacanau–Arcachon Cycle Path – Port of Biganos loop from Le Teich offers a ride that brings you closer to the coastal environment and the Port of Biganos. Many routes also pass by lakes like Hostens, offering scenic water views.
